Established in 2010, the OFFline Film Festival has grown into a beacon for filmmakers and cinephiles alike, offering a unique platform to showcase creativity and talent. This five-day event, set against the charming backdrop of Birr, Co. Offaly, is not just about screening films; it’s an immersive experience designed to inspire and connect.
The festival's Animation Competition, with a maximum runtime of 15 minutes, stands as a testament to its commitment to nurturing diverse storytelling techniques.
